two copies of a color photograph postcard of the docks beside the Balboa Ferry landing taken from an elevated position looking towards the Pavilion. The docks have several power boats docked there and two sailboats with their sails unfurled. There is a ferry pulling away from the dock on the left side.
Both unused. Published by the Drown news Agency in Long Beach and printed by H. S. Crocker Co., Inc, in San Francisco. Postcard number DN-36. Stamp box says Place Stamp here with vertical lines behind it.Subject
